A lot of these comments could and would have been made about any bubblecar that might have managed to last to 1969. Even the Goggo was on its last gasp as the AWS Piccola/Shopper. It answers the questions to anyone who queries why the Microcar pretty much died out. The customer wanted and could see better. It is a matter of interest that ICs were the last of the Microcars really but by dint of Government subsidy to a restricted group of drivers. I suggest this means they have to be considered microcars at this time while I totally accept their status as a differing class of vehicle. Nothing is ever simple.
